Why India Is The Most Underrated Digital Nomad Destination

India is a country of contrasts, with a rich history and culture. It has one of the oldest civilizations in the world, with a history dating back thousands of years. But beyond the history, it is rapidly becoming a hub for digital nomads who seek more than just a beach and a laptop.

1. Unmatched Value for Money

While Southeast Asia has long been the favorite for nomads, India offers an even deeper value. From luxury heritage stays in Rajasthan to modern apartments in Goa, your dollar or euro goes significantly further here. This allows nomads to focus on high-quality experiences and deep work without the financial stress of high-cost cities.

2. Infrastructure is catching up

The narrative that India has "bad Wi-Fi" is outdated. In major tech hubs and curated nomad communities like SyncRetreat, enterprise-grade, load-balanced internet is the standard. With 5G rollout and fiber-to-the-home becoming ubiquitous, the technical barriers have vanished.

3. A Culture of Innovation

India is home to one of the world's largest startup ecosystems. When you work from here, you aren't just surrounded by tourists; you're surrounded by founders, engineers, and creators who are building the future. The networking opportunities are high-signal and high-impact.

4. Geographic Diversity

Whether you want the high-altitude focus of the Himalayas (Ladakh) or the coastal flow of the Arabian Sea (Goa), India offers environments that cater to every type of deep-work preference.
